Biomedical and healthcare engineering is concerned with applying scientific and engineering principles to the design, development and operation of the technology that modern healthcare depends on. This ranges from diagnostic equipment such as MRI scanners and ultrasound machines to monitoring devices, prosthetics, surgical tools and the systems used to manage patient data. It is a discipline that requires you to understand both the engineering and the clinical context, because a device that works in the laboratory must also work safely and effectively with patients and clinicians.
